When Your News Builds a Memory

A personal news system becomes more useful as it turns individual stories into a connected history that can resurface context without creating another reading queue.

A personal news feed can become more than a stream of items when each story adds to a connected record. New coverage can appear when relevant without joining an unread queue that demands attention, so resurfacing an older thread doesn’t automatically create another obligation.

That distinction rests on how the archive is built. The system identifies the nodes and other elements inside each story, then follows those links across earlier coverage. A report involving Donald Trump can lead back to other stories involving him, while reporting on Nvidia’s AI development can reconnect with a particular data-center implementation. The archive therefore preserves relationships that a chronological list would leave scattered.

Those connections need time to accumulate, which means the useful memory emerges only after the system has been running for a while. Once enough stories have supplied people, companies and developments to follow, earlier coverage becomes a resource for later questions as well as for related-story retrieval. Its value grows from the history it has actually collected, while relevant stories can still surface without being treated as unfinished reading.
